Jesper Pettersson is a scholar working on Mechanical Engineering, Aerospace Engineering and Materials Chemistry. According to data from OpenAlex, Jesper Pettersson has authored 20 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Mechanical Engineering, 9 papers in Aerospace Engineering and 9 papers in Materials Chemistry. Recurrent topics in Jesper Pettersson’s work include High-Temperature Coating Behaviors (9 papers), Metallurgical Processes and Thermodynamics (8 papers) and Hydrogen embrittlement and corrosion behaviors in metals (4 papers). Jesper Pettersson is often cited by papers focused on High-Temperature Coating Behaviors (9 papers), Metallurgical Processes and Thermodynamics (8 papers) and Hydrogen embrittlement and corrosion behaviors in metals (4 papers). Jesper Pettersson collaborates with scholars based in Sweden, Norway and Finland. Jesper Pettersson's co-authors include Jan‐Erik Svensson, Kent Davidsson, Ulf Jäglid, John Korsgren, Lars‐Gunnar Johansson, Lars-Erik Åmand, L.‐G. Johansson, Håkan Kassman, Britt‐Marie Steenari and Nicklas Folkeson and has published in prestigious journals such as Corrosion Science, Fuel and Surface Science.
